write an answer to the guiding question: why do horses have hooves instead of multiple toes on each foot?

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

Over time, through evolution, horses developed hooves as an adaptation for speed and endurance on open - grassland habitats. Hooves provide a single, sturdy point of contact that allows for faster running and better support of their body weight while traveling long distances.
